🚨 The U.S. could be taking control of Venezuela’s oil pipeline.

President Donald Trump said that a new oil deal could bring the U.S. 55% of output from production projects in Venezuela.

According to reports, the project will focus on 17 strategic fields in the Orinoco Belt and Lake Maracaibo, with proposed production rights of up to 100 years.

Notably, the plan could also attract nearly $100B in private investment capital, while Venezuela expects to collect up to $209B in tax revenue.

But there’s one major issue: the entire deal has not yet been announced, the name of the private operator has not been disclosed, and the legal basis still raises many questions.
